The Eden Project is celebrating its 100th ‘Eden Session’ this weekend, with headline acts including Nile Rodgers & CHIC and Doves.

With the century performance to be headlined on Sunday by the multiple Grammy-winning artist, the surrounding sessions are sold out. This momentous performance is set to be the highlight of what is hoped to be the greatest session season to date.

Rita Broe, Executive Producer of the organisation, said: “What a moment for the Eden Sessions! We are incredibly proud to be bringing back some of our favourite artists for this very special 100th show, headlined by our great friend Nile Rodgers. It will be a unique moment in our history that we hope will live long in the memory.”

This will be the third time Rodgers has performed at The Eden Project, after he made his debut Eden Session in 2013 and returned three years later for the BBC Music Day concert in 2016.

The sold-out line-ups surrounding Sunday’s performance include Liam Gallagher, Fontains D.C and The Velvet Hands, on Wednesday June 26, The Chemical Brothers and DJ James Holroyd on Friday June 28, Snow Patrol on Saturday June 29, and Kylie Minogue and Nina Nesbitt on July 2 and 3.

With such an eclectic, impressive collection of artists in store for their 18th year, Broe added that the Eden Sessions are “really excited to be bringing the Good Times to Eden for 2019”.

An extended line-up for Sunday’s showcase includes Doves, a Manchester alternative rock three piece again returning for their third performance at Eden; the London-based electronica band the Asian Dub Foundation as well as artists Dreadzone, Bill Jefferson and Backbeat Soundsystem.
